Transaction 15dfbe2cfa4c13e41610daf4f7652896a6502bd39e75e12ac78b5d7906915708
1 Input
2 Outputs
- 15dfbe2cfa4c13e41610daf4f7652896a6502bd39e75e12ac78b5d7906915708:0
- 15dfbe2cfa4c13e41610daf4f7652896a6502bd39e75e12ac78b5d7906915708:1
value 379
address 1M3EaGBrt2yS1KZPTQMTMFPESF74gbGSp6
value 3983466
address 1JKNeAMiEAU8kDa9WN9yNdvaeJo4UZUUmZ